AAA umbrella policies cover claims beyond the financial limits of an existing auto or home insurance policy, though availability may vary by regional AAA club. AAA umbrella policies may also cover claims for things like slander, libel, and psychological harm, which might not be covered by standard liability insurance.
An umbrella insurance policy from AAA can add $1 million or more in additional liability coverage. In some regions, AAA umbrella policies start at $240 annually for $1 million in coverage.
What AAA Umbrella Policies Cover
- Injuries to other people if you're at fault
- Damage to others' property if you're at fault
- Lawsuits and legal fees for things like slander, false imprisonment and arrest, or lost wages due to injury
- Injuries or damage caused by your renters
AAA's umbrella policies are a good choice for customers with a high net worth who want extra coverage for property damage, injuries, and possible lawsuits that could result from various types of incidents. You can get a quote for AAA umbrella insurance by calling your regional AAA insurance office.
